    Overview

    The Rubik's cube has approximately 519 quintillion possible arrangements, (5.19 x 10^20). In 2010 a group of mathematicians and computer scientists proved that any Rubik's cube can be solved in at most 20 moves.

    Most Rubik's cubes are made from an arrangement of 3x3x3 smaller cubes, although some larger arrangements do exist.
